Pasadena, Calif. — Dine Brands International is set to expand its dual-branded Applebee’s and IHOP concept in 2025. This expansion includes entering the Costa Rican market with franchisee BLT UK Holdings Limited, and opening the first non-traditional restaurants in Mexico with franchisees Grupo Shogua and ATH Group. The dual-branded format, combining Applebee’s and IHOP under one roof, has been a key part of Dine Brands’ international growth strategy. West Covina, Calif. — Jollibee, a global fast-food fried chicken concept based in the Philippines, is launching its first franchising program in the U.S. The quick-service restaurant (QSR) chain is the flagship brand of Jollibee Foods Corporation (JFC), also known as the Jollibee Group, one of the world’s fastest-growing restaurant companies. Jollibee opened its first North American location in 1998 in Daly City, Calif., and currently operates 76 stores spanning 14 states in the U.S. and 28 stores in Canada.
